Форум программистов, компьютерный форум, киберфорум
С++ для начинающих
Войти
Регистрация
Восстановить пароль
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.95/21: Рейтинг темы: голосов - 21, средняя оценка - 4.95
139 / 60 / 13
Регистрация: 04.09.2011
Сообщений: 1,956
Записей в блоге: 1

Ошибка при компиляции

06.12.2013, 20:27. Показов 4563. Ответов 5
Метки нет (Все метки)

Студворк — интернет-сервис помощи студентам
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
#include <iostream>
#include <string>
#include <cstdlib>
#include <cstdio>
#include <algorithm>
#include <vector>
 
using namespace std;
 
typedef vector<string> Text;
 
bool can_be_grouped(const string&, const string&);
 
int main()
{
    freopen("input.txt", "r", stdin);
    freopen("output.txt", "w", stdout);
 
    Text my_text;
 
    string cur_word;
   
    while(cin >> cur_word)
        my_text.push_back(cur_word);
   
 
    sort(my_text.begin(), my_text.end());
   
    int group_index = 1;
 
    string prev_word;
    prev_word = my_text[0];
 
    cout << "Group #" << group_index << endl
            << prev_word << endl;
 
    for(size_t i = 1; i < my_text.size(); ++i)
    {
        if(can_be_grouped(prev_word, my_text[i]))
            cout << my_text[i] << endl;
        else
            cout << "Group #" << ++group_index << endl
                << my_text[i] << endl;
 
        prev_word = my_text[i];
    }
 
    return 0;
}
 
bool can_be_grouped(const string& str1, const string& str2)
{
    return  ((str1[0] == str2[0]) && (str1[1] == str2[1]) && (str1[2] == str2[2]));
}
Вот ощибка
Ошибка 1 error C4996: 'freopen': This function or variable may be unsafe. Consider using freopen_s instead. To disable deprecation, use _CRT_SECURE_NO_WARNINGS. See online help for details. c:\users\lg\desktop\код.cpp 16 1 1
что не правельно
0
cpp_developer
Эксперт
20123 / 5690 / 1417
Регистрация: 09.04.2010
Сообщений: 22,546
Блог
06.12.2013, 20:27
Ответы с готовыми решениями:

Ошибка при компиляции. Где ошибка? (Работа с классом)
Уважаемые форумчане! При компиляции проекта возникает ошибка &quot; undefined reference to `MeterNZiF::MeterNZiF()' &quot; на 7 строку...

Ошибка памяти при выполнении, при компиляции не выводит ошибки
ПОмогите плс программа вводит строку символов до точки, а после вычисляет процент согласных в этой строке и выводит их в обратном порядке....

Не является внутренней или внешней командой - ошибка не при компиляции а при работе программы
В VS скомпилировал код #include &lt;iostream&gt; using namespace std; int main() { int a; cout&lt;&lt;&quot;Hallo&quot;; cin&gt;&gt;a; ...

5
 Аватар для programina
2062 / 619 / 41
Регистрация: 23.10.2011
Сообщений: 4,468
Записей в блоге: 2
06.12.2013, 20:32
Цитата Сообщение от Sylar9 Посмотреть сообщение
что не правельно
...
Цитата Сообщение от Sylar9 Посмотреть сообщение
freopen_s instead
0
503 / 352 / 94
Регистрация: 22.03.2011
Сообщений: 1,112
06.12.2013, 20:39
У Вас есть выбор:
1. Подавить варнинг _CRT_SECURE_NO_WARNINGS
2. Использовать freopen_s
3. Игнорировать
4. Использовать std::fstream (предпочтительно!)
0
06.12.2013, 20:49

Не по теме:

Цитата Сообщение от stima Посмотреть сообщение
У Вас есть выбор:
Пока...:) После 10-й студии выбор уменьшился.
Цитата Сообщение от stima Посмотреть сообщение
Подавить варнинг
Это уже error:
Ошибка 1 error C4996:
Цитата Сообщение от stima Посмотреть сообщение
3. Игнорировать
В 10-й можно было (предупреждение), а здесь как? Навязывание нестандарта.

0
Неэпический
 Аватар для Croessmah
18149 / 10731 / 2067
Регистрация: 27.09.2012
Сообщений: 27,035
Записей в блоге: 1
06.12.2013, 20:53
delete
0
2022 / 1621 / 489
Регистрация: 31.05.2009
Сообщений: 3,005
06.12.2013, 21:48
Цитата Сообщение от Sylar9 Посмотреть сообщение
что не правельно
Цитата Сообщение от Sylar9 Посмотреть сообщение
Ошибка 1 error C4996: 'freopen': This function or variable may be unsafe. Consider using freopen_s instead. To disable deprecation, use _CRT_SECURE_NO_WARNINGS. See online help for details.
http://msdn.microsoft.com/en-u... 0s5kh.aspx
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
raxper
Эксперт
30234 / 6612 / 1498
Регистрация: 28.12.2010
Сообщений: 21,154
Блог
06.12.2013, 21:48
Помогаю со студенческими работами здесь

Использование шаблонов при наследовании, ошибка при компиляции
При изучении списков написал шаблон протестировал, все работает. После написал класс наследник от шаблона List.h, компилятор выдает...

При компиляции ошибка. Ошибка c++ C2678
Ошибка c++ C2678 #include &lt;windows.h&gt; #include &lt;string&gt; #include &lt;iostream&gt; #include &lt;conio.h&gt; #include &lt;fstream&gt; #include...

Ошибка при компиляции
//--------------------------------------------------------------------------- #include &lt;vcl.h&gt; #pragma hdrstop #include &quot;Unit1.h&quot; ...

Ошибка при компиляции
Посмотрите пожалуйста в чем ошибка тут и что нужно исправить ? #include &lt;iostream&gt; int fac(int n) { int fac; int...

Ошибка при компиляции
#include &lt;iostream&gt; #include &lt;ctype.h&gt; using namespace std; int main(){ const int n=12; ñhar S; int k={}; bool b=false; ...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
6
Ответ Создать тему
Новые блоги и статьи
Переходник USB-CAN-GPIO
Eddy_Em 20.03.2026
Достаточно давно на работе возникла необходимость в переходнике CAN-USB с гальваноразвязкой, оный и был разработан. Однако, все меня терзала совесть, что аж 48-ногий МК используется так тупо: просто. . .
Оттенки серого
Argus19 18.03.2026
Оттенки серого Нашёл в интернете 3 прекрасных модуля: Модуль класса открытия диалога открытия/ сохранения файла на Win32 API; Модуль класса быстрого перекодирования цветного изображения в оттенки. . .
SDL3 для Desktop (MinGW): Рисуем цветные прямоугольники с помощью рисовальщика SDL3 на Си и C++
8Observer8 17.03.2026
Содержание блога Финальные проекты на Си и на C++: finish-rectangles-sdl3-c. zip finish-rectangles-sdl3-cpp. zip
Символические и жёсткие ссылки в Linux.
algri14 15.03.2026
Существует два типа ссылок — символические и жёсткие. Ссылка в Linux — это запись в каталоге, которая может указывать либо на inode «файла-ИСТОЧНИКА», тогда это будет «жёсткая ссылка» (hard link),. . .
[Owen Logic] Поддержание уровня воды в резервуаре количеством включённых насосов: моделирование и выбор регулятора
ФедосеевПавел 14.03.2026
Поддержание уровня воды в резервуаре количеством включённых насосов: моделирование и выбор регулятора ВВЕДЕНИЕ Выполняя задание на управление насосной группой заполнения резервуара,. . .
делаю науч статью по влиянию грибов на сукцессию
anaschu 13.03.2026
прикрепляю статью
SDL3 для Desktop (MinGW): Создаём пустое окно с нуля для 2D-графики на SDL3, Си и C++
8Observer8 10.03.2026
Содержание блога Финальные проекты на Си и на C++: hello-sdl3-c. zip hello-sdl3-cpp. zip Результат:
Установка CMake и MinGW 13.1 для сборки С и C++ приложений из консоли и из Qt Creator в EXE
8Observer8 10.03.2026
Содержание блога MinGW - это коллекция инструментов для сборки приложений в EXE. CMake - это система сборки приложений. Здесь описаны базовые шаги для старта программирования с помощью CMake и. . .
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2026, CyberForum.ru